Definition of day unit: = 24 h = 1440 min. One day (solar day) is period of time from noon to noon = 24 hours. A solar day is the time it takes for the Earth to rotate about its axis so that the Sun appears in the same position in the sky. 24 [h] × 3600 [s] = 86.4 [ks] = 86400 [s]
Definition of Callippic cycle unit: ≡ 76 years (Julian). One callippic cycle is equal to 441 mo (hollow) + 499 mo (full) = 76 a of 365.25 d = 2.3983776 Gs
